Rapid City, SD-based Black Hills Corp. has named John Benton vice president and general manager of the energy holding company’s oil and gas production unit, Black Hills Exploration & Production. Benton is replacing John Vering, a Black Hills board member who has served as interim CEO of the E&P unit and will return to his board position. With bachelor’s and master’s degrees in petroleum engineering from Colorado School of Mines, Benton comes to Black Hills from Rex Energy Corp., where he headed development of the company’s Niobrara acreage in Wyoming and Colorado.

Dynegy Holdings, Four Subsidiaries File For Chapter 11

Dynegy Inc. announced Monday that its holding company and four additional subsidiaries have filed for Chapter 11 bankruptcy protection after reaching an agreement with its major investors, including billionaire Carl Icahn and Seneca Capital.

CME Clearing in ‘Strong Financial Position’ After MF Global Bankruptcy

After reviewing orders from bankrupt securities firm MF Global Holdings Ltd., CME Clearing, a trading arm of CME Group, said it was holding “substantial excess margin collateral” and continued to be in a “strong financial position” with respect to MF Global and in general.

Industry Briefs

Gulfmark Energy Group Inc. of San Antonio, TX, said it has obtained financing from Notre-Dame Capital Inc. of Montreal to support development of its Eagle Ford Shale assets. The company said it intends to drill through the Escondido, Olmos, San Miguel, Austin Chalk and Eagle Ford formations. “We have yet to assess all of the undeveloped potential opportunities to expand our operations utilizing horizontal wells with multi-stage fracturing technologies,” said CEO Michael Ward. “Multiple targets have been identified; however, several other opportunities are currently under evaluation and analysis. This financing will allow us to explore all resources available in our current asset base.” Gulfmark operations are currently focused on western South Texas. Terms of the financing were not disclosed.

Enterprise Offering Marcellus-Mont Belvieu Ethane Capacity

Enterprise Products Partners LP is holding a binding open season through Nov. 10 for capacity on its proposed pipeline to transport ethane from the Marcellus and Utica shales to the U.S. Gulf Coast.

More Gas Storage Possible for Clay Basin

Questar Pipeline Co. is holding a nonbinding open season through Oct. 31 for 8 Bcf of additional firm storage capacity at its Clay Basin Storage Reservoir, as well as projects to connect Clay Basin directly to Overthrust Pipeline Co. and other pipelines near Kanda, WY.

DCP Midstream Offering NGL Capacity to Texas

DCP Midstream is holding a binding open season through Oct. 31 for capacity on its proposed Southern Hills Pipeline. The company said it is moving toward a fourth quarter close on its acquisition of Seaway Products Pipeline Co., whose assets would be part of the Southern Hills natural gas liquids (NGL) project.

Industry Brief

Crosstex NGL Pipeline LP is holding a binding open season through Oct. 14 for capacity on a new natural gas liquids (NGL) pipeline system (the Crosstex NGL Pipeline) to transport unfractionated NGLs produced in the Permian Basin, Midcontinent, Barnett Shale, Eagle Ford Shale and Rocky Mountain areas from the Mont Belvieu, TX, area to NGL fractionation facilities in Eunice and Riverside, LA. Crosstex Energy LP and Crosstex Energy Inc. plan to construct the common carrier pipeline with a preliminary design capacity of at least 70,000 b/d to Eunice, with a lesser amount of capacity available to Riverside (see Shale Daily, July 27).
